Case Study Company E: Ferris/Turney

Company Profile

Company E is a highly specialized construction company-a general contractor that specializes in tenant improvement projects; within this market, they primarily work on sensitive environment-occupied space projects.

Company E's construction services focus on Medical and Dental Clinics, Hospitals, Biotech and other Processing Laboratories, as well as a mix of Business and Class A offices, retail and showroom spaces.

Company E also performs turnkey design-build tenant improvement alterations and renovations; its service department provides customers with fast response design-build small projects along with commercial repair and maintenance projects, many are initiated and completed within days and hours when required.

Situation

The CEO/owner of Company E had spent the past 6-8 months reorganizing the company in order to position it for growth. The administration of the business had been taking more and more of the owner's time and his sales efforts were being impacted by the growing amount of time being spent in the office and away from responding to client requests for pricing and proposals as well as visiting and working with his site project management. The owner needed an administrative office set up that would provide him with timely and dependable data with which he could run his business on less than 15 hours per week of administration and financial reporting review.

Solution

Barry MacKechnie, founder of CEO Services, initiated his proven methodology and process for helping CEOs and business owners analyze their business operational requirements and then establishing the procedures and hiring the personnel to maintain the systems and daily reporting required to operate a business successfully.

MacKechnie worked with the owner of Company E and reviewed the current financial operations and personnel requirements. MacKechnie worked with the owner on identifying and contracting the services of a contract CFO that would provide the business with strong financial oversight as well as providing guidance to the controller and other administration staff. The owner and MacKechnie developed the scope of services for a two phase contract that was negotiated with a contract CFO services company. A CFO with strong financial background was brought in for Phase 1 to reconcile the financial information and provide the owner with accurate current financial statements. Phase 2 utilized the same CFO to provide guidance and training to a newly hired controller as well as provide oversight on the daily, weekly and monthly operations of the office team. That same CFO will also review the financial statements at the end of each month with the owner to confirm its accuracy and reliability. The contracted services provide the owner with a consistent team that is working as a cohesive unit to provide him with accurate and timely financial data as well as enhanced monitoring and reporting methods.
